“No one has made Disney more money recently than me,” the Florida governor said on Monday. “Because during Covid, they were open in Florida.”

DeSantis’ feud with Disney began last year, sparked after the company publicly criticized Florida’s Republican-controlled Legislature for approving a bill banning teachers from leading discussions on gender identity and sexual orientation, a measure that came to be known as the “Don’t Say Gay” bill.

In April, Disney took the battle to federal court, alleging that DeSantis and other state officials retaliated against the company and violated its First Amendment rights. In May, the Central Florida Tourism Oversight District brought its own state lawsuit against Disney, alleging that a deal struck over the company’s authority over itself violated state law.

The Florida governor’s tussle with the company has drawn criticism from his political opponents as he seeks the GOP presidential nomination. DeSantis’ comments on Monday are some of the first signs he might be willing to stand down.
